Cable modem

A cable modem is a type of network bridge or gateway that provides bi-directional data communication via radio frequency channels on a hybrid fiber-coaxial, radio frequency over glass and coaxial cable infrastructure. Cable modems are primarily used to deliver broadband Internet access in the form of cable Internet.
